Bladebarrow is a temple in the Edgelands featured in Fable: The Journey.
Overview
Bladebarrow is a temple of the Enlightened located within Miremoor Henge in the Edgelands. The temple bears the Willstone of Stone.
Bladebarrow seems to be the largest of the known Enlightened temples, and its structure is mainly and simply composed by a series of underground tunnels and galleries which extend themselves for longer distances than the gameplay allows Gabriel to explore.
Aside of the main temple, Bladebarrow holds a series of ancient catacombs, which can be easily noticed due to the amount of skeletons and tombs inside, which are aligned with Stone's title as the "Hero of the fallen" (referring to the fallen heroes and townsfolk of old). Bladebarrow, as the name suggest, is also teeming with many metal blades, of great size, hanging in chains from the ceiling or partially embed in the ground and walls of the underground tunnels, it is also noticeable that the cave system contains a great number of cliffs around the main path, a feature that Gabriel recalls as bottomless pits.
The portion of Bladebarrow which holds the trials any hero must face in order to obtain Stone's willstone contains not only swarms of Rockmites and ancient puzzles and booby traps, such as rolling boulders, but will also and quickly try to overpower the player with many hordes of Hollow Men which are formed by restless wisps possessing the many corpses contained in the catacombs inside Bladebarrow.
One of the most noticeable landscapes of Bladebarrow is the great amounts of waters that pours from the surface to what appears to be an underground river that flows within the temple, which Ghostlight comments to be the "pathway to eternal life", which is also the responsible to create the unnatural mist filled with hollow men that Gabriel must cross in order to reach the main temple area.
The main temple area, however, greatly resembles the other Enlightened temples, and is basically composed by the magic pool where Stone's willstone is hidden and a tree with magical characteristics that reflects the power of the temple's willstone, in this case, the tree has the appearance of a hollow tree with no leaves whatsoever once again linking its meaning with Stone's title as the “Hero of the Fallen”.
Lore

Fable: The Journey
Built during Albion's anarchist period following the demise of the Old Kingdom, the temple contains a series of challenges designed to judge the worthiness of someone seeking the Willstone. Much of the temple is also a tomb, containing the bodies of warriors of old and their restless spirits, who have become aggressive enough to reanimate the bones of the dead as hollow men. Bladebarrow is guarded by Ghostlight, a wisp who was once a member of the Enlightened who was chosen for the position due to his "dependable disposition". Ironically, the wisp suffered from a dual personality disorder.
